The Doctor of Dental Medicine will prepare you for a rewarding career as a qualified dental practitioner to enrich and provide quality oral healthcare within your local community.
This 3.5-year full-time program is a graduate-entry program intended for those with a background in health, allied health, or physical or biological sciences.
The innovative curriculum is designed to condense your studies and provide you with all the training, skills and knowledge to be able to prevent, diagnose and treat oral conditions across a diverse range of oral health conditions.
During your program, you will practice advanced critical thinking and reasoning to develop a research-informed clinical practice.
From your second year, you’ll undertake 2,000 hours of supervised clinical placements to apply your knowledge and broaden your clinical skills in a real setting.

Admission Requirements
To be eligible for entry, you'll need:
- A bachelor's degree (or equivalent) in health, allied health, physical sciences or biological sciences, and
- To have successfully completed university-level study in human anatomy and human physiology or cellular physiology, within the 10 years prior to program commencement, and
- To have completed the GAMSAT within 4 years prior to the year of commencement.
